How does work?

Depending on what you’re looking for, uses counseling for couples, people, or households. You develop an account and submit a questionnaire to discover the right match.

Throughout the survey, you’re able to note out your therapist preferences, including their gender, religion, age, sexual orientation, language, in addition to what issues you’re wanting to deal with, and how crucial it is that your counselor be well versed in those topics.

It can take anywhere from a few hours to a number of days to be matched to an in-state therapist.

According to, therapists are accredited, trained, experienced, and recognized psychologists, marriage and family therapists, clinical social workers, or certified expert therapists.

All the business’s counselors have a master’s or doctorate degree and have a minimum of 3 years and 2,000 hours of experience as psychological health experts.

You can just email to be reassigned if you don’t like who you’re paired with.

As soon as you’ve been matched with a counselor, you can immediately begin messaging them in a private and safe chat room.

The chatroom is accessible at any time as long as your device has trusted internet. Messaging isn’t performed in real-time, so there’s no surefire reaction time from your counselor. As a result, you’re free to message your counselor at any hour of the day.

Your therapist will reply with questions, homework, feedback, or guidance, and the app will inform you of their response.

The conversations are saved in the chatroom so you’re totally free to reread and reflect whenever you ‘d like. Every conversation is also safeguarded by rigorous federal and state HIPAA laws.

Faced with joining a frantically long NHS waiting list, Joe Rackham chose online counselling rather. “I just felt that I couldn’t wait any longer– I was encouraged and prepared to handle my concerns and rather liked the idea of doing so in the convenience of my own home,” stated the 29-year-old, who resides in London. After an online search, he discovered a therapist whose profile fit his needs and scheduled a chat session for the next day.

The physician app Babylon offers treatment to 150,000 active users, while PlusGuidance, an online counselling service, has 10,000 users. Talkspace, another online therapy platform, reports it has actually 500,000 signed up users worldwide, with a lot of in the United States.

 

Online training recommends therapists on everything from utilizing emojis to preventing misinterpretations. They likewise need to secure clients’ personal information– an issue that has actually caused debate in the US, where big online treatment platforms have come under the spotlight.

Buckley stated patients ought to check services’ privacy policies prior to registering. “Not all online counselling sites utilize professionally trained therapists or stick to an ethics policy, so ask your GP for a suggestion in the first circumstances. As with all kinds of services and assistance, what works for one person might not work for somebody else,” he said.

Marc Bush, chief policy consultant at Young Minds, stated that while online counselling services are valuable, “they should not replace face-to-face therapy with a qualified expert. If a young person is having a hard time, we would encourage them to talk to their GP in the very first circumstances, or to get in touch with a recognized service like The Mix, Childline or the Samaritans.”.

For Rackham, who has actually generalised anxiety condition, online counselling wasn’t the best fit. “I felt it was near difficult for the therapist to really get a sense of the problems I was handling, as all they needed to go from was my typed-out words. I believe I realised after that online session how vital interpersonal interaction was.

” I’m a big fan of using technology in all areas of my life as an option to everyday issues. I have apps for whatever, but when it pertains to mental health, you need to pick how technology contributes in your recovery really thoroughly.”.
